Trait: post-traumatic stress disorder

Experimental Factor Ontology (EFO) Information
Identifier EFO_0001358
Description An anxiety disorder precipitated by an experience of intense fear or horror while exposed to a traumatic (especially life-threatening) event. The disorder is characterized by intrusive recurring thoughts or images of the traumatic event; avoidance of anything associated with the event; a state of hyperarousal and diminished emotional responsiveness. These symptoms are present for at least one month and the disorder is usually long-term. [NCIT: P378]
